Common Bifold Door Issues

Before diving into the fixes, it is important to comprehend the common problems related to bifold doors. Here's a summary of the most frequently reported concerns:

IssueDescriptionPotential Causes
MisalignmentDoors do not line up properly when closed.Improper installation, warped frame.
Sticking or JammingDifficulty in opening or closing the doors smoothly.Dirt, debris, or lack of lubrication in the track.
Excessive GapUneven gaps between door panels when closed.Settling of the building, loose screws.
Loud operationLoud creaking or grinding noises when running the doors.Damaged rollers, dirt in the track.
Trouble lockingLock mechanisms refusing to engage properly.Misalignment or broken lock hardware.
Broken glassFractures or shatters in the glass panels.Effect damage, severe weather modifications.

Understanding these problems can help house owners troubleshoot successfully before delving into repairs.

FAQs

Q1: How often should I maintain my bifold doors?

A: It's recommended to clean and lubricate bifold doors at least two times a year, or more frequently if they see a lot of usage.

Q2: Can I fix bifold doors myself or should I employ a professional?

A: Many common problems can be dealt with by property owners. However, significant problems like broken glass or complex alignment issues may require professional help.

Q3: What type of lube is best for bifold doors?

A: Silicone-based lubricants are perfect as they do not collect dirt like oil-based products-- keeping your tracks and rollers clean.

Q4: Are bifold doors energy efficient?

A: Yes, bifold doors can be energy-efficient, especially if they have actually insulated glass and appropriate weatherstripping.

Q5: What should I do if I presume my bifold door is deforming?

A: Check the frame for signs of damage or excessive moisture. If warping is extreme, think about changing the afflicted panel or seeking advice from a professional.
